    MERRY CHRISTMAS. I got my very first rifle when I was 16. It was a REMINGTON Nylon 66. Just about a year ago it was returned to me by a friend that I left it with when I was being sent overseas. That was 20 years ago and we'd lost touch but then he found me through the Internet and drove from Wyoming to see me and return it along with a couple of other guns I had left with him. Brings back some great memories of being outdoors in north central Texas before all the concrete and asphalt replaced the prairie, cows, and jack rabbits.
